SERP Tracking is a SERP monitoring tool built for marketing and SEO use cases. Its main goal is to help users understand how a given domain performs on search results pages. According to the page, it can provide information such as keyword positions, visibility changes, page appearances, and broader search movement trends, helping teams identify changes in search results and potential SEO opportunities.
Based on the scraped text, the product focuses on Keyword & SERP Tracking, Visibility & SERP Changes, and Page-Level Search Insights. In other words, it does not only track rankings for individual keywords, but also emphasizes changes in a domainβs overall SERP visibility and can analyze, at the page level, which pages are gaining or losing search exposure. These capabilities are useful for daily rank monitoring, SEO project reviews, tracking the performance of content pages, and investigating search volatility.
The page does not specify its data sources, such as whether the data comes from Google, Bing, or other search engines. It also does not disclose key metrics such as supported countries, languages, device types, refresh frequency, or historical data coverage. The only scale-related claim is that it is βTrusted by 85,000+ SaaS & SEO teams,β but this is more of a marketing endorsement and should not be treated as an indication of keyword database size or SERP data coverage.
The scraped content does not provide any plan details, pricing, billing model, or free trial information, nor does it mention supported payment methods. On the integration side, it also does not state whether it supports Google Search Console, Google Analytics, Slack, Looker Studio, an API, or report exports. For procurement evaluation, buyers should therefore confirm budget requirements, data access, collaboration features, and automated reporting capabilities in advance.
The main advantage is its focused positioning: it centers on keyword rankings, SERP changes, and page-level insights, making it suitable for teams that need to quickly understand fluctuations in organic search. The downside is the lack of public information: pricing, data coverage, update frequency, platform support, customer support, and integration capabilities are not clearly explained. The page also contains a fair amount of repeated content, resulting in relatively low information density.
It is best suited for SaaS companies, SEO teams, content growth teams, and website operators that need to monitor organic search visibility.
